I have been using this mouse now for three weeks. Yes it is not rechargeable and I prefer a battery over charging. You get the standard mouse clicks nothing different about it. The mouse is a standard size ergo and fits my hands perfectly but everyone has different hand sizes so YMMV. I like that I can switch between three different connections with the tap of a button. I use this on my desktop and work laptop. I'm using the bluetooth connection and have had not drops or connection issues.
